E.ON hikes bills for 1m customers on coldest spring day on record

Big-six power firm quietly removes discounts on dual-fuel and paperless tariffsAround a million households face higher bills for gas and electricity after the big-six power firm E.ON quietly increased prices on the coldest spring day on record.Comparison sites and consumer groups described the move, expected to be the first of a series of price increases from energy providers, as devastating news for hard-pressed households.
